# Settings for Gridwrangler, our crossword generator service.
# Heads up for release managers: the puzzle cache gets rebuilt on
# every deploy, so expect a few minutes of slow grid generation
# right after rollout — that's normal, don't panic. Word-list
# refreshes pull from the Lexicrate dictionary table nightly.
# Keep the solver timeout at 12s unless the Sunday-size grids
# start failing. The generator reads its word database via the
# connection string directly below this comment.

replica DSN, kajep-yahag: mssql://praok_svc:iF@db-8d68.plorvaio.local:5432/eliion

## Runbook: Soft Deletes in `orders`

At Larkspur Commerce, rows in `orders` are never hard-deleted. Instead, set `deleted_at` to the current timestamp; downstream ETL jobs filter on this column. If a customer requests restoration, null the field and re-trigger the sync job. Always run these updates against the primary, which you can reach with the connection string below.

primary connection of tajeg-tajop = postgresql://julax_svc:DI@db-e7f3.kelvidyn.corp:5432/rusdor

CI note — Cindermill export pipeline. Failed exports now retry up to three times with backoff; retries reuse the original signed payload, so no new credentials are minted mid-run. Security reviewers should confirm the retry path still enforces the scope check on each attempt, not just the first. Audit logs capture every attempt. The pipeline build under review is shown below.

build token for tawip-yageg: htk9_92ac43d42